    This needs to be reconsidered especially for Enterprise level accounts. The simple fact of user experience when managing files alone should be enough, but more to the point, if a user creates the folder beforehand and then navigates back to the content they want to move, they have to then navigate in the Copy/Move dialogue to where they created their folder.
    Why? The search in that dialogue either hasn't indexed the new folder yet, or the specific workflow may be that users are creating folders of the same name in their structures and the search could return 100's of them leaving the users the painful task of finding the correct one.

    We consider this an absolute must as an enterprise solution that we are able to enforce passwords for all shared links, it came as a surprise the setting wasn't there in the first place and is being perceived by our clients as a public file sharing solution.
    We have added it to our best practises for users to add one, but unfortunately during 1 week where 4000+ files/folders we shared only 5 were given passwords.
    This is deemed as a major security flaw as we are leaving data exposed.

    As an organisation we are getting assistance on doing some development around this, but it needs to be baked into the product as an admin setting, especially at the enterprise tier offerings.
